    Thanks for this video! Love all these tips! I too am working full time remote, salaried and homeschooling. Last homeschool year we schooled 5 days a week. It was tough but we made it through and I learned a lot. we were schooling 5 days a week but this next year I am hoping to just do a 4 day work week. I think a couple things you mentioned were spot on-the kids need to learn to be more independent. Also- so important not to put yourself last. So many times there were days I wouldn’t even get to shower and I would just feel so horrible about myself. Time management is so important- i have realized going to bed early so I can wake up early has been so important. Also- meal prepping/planning has helped so much! This year I want to be able to add more enrichment. I would love to be able to take my kids on some sort of outing/field trip once a month. Thankfully my mother is retired and is such a great support system and can also take my boys to do something fun. Co ops can be so hard. So many around me are either a specific type (classical conversations ect) or they require the parent to teach a class. It’s just not very doable for me unfortunately.

    I am similar work FT from home 4/5 days a week. One day in office. I’m looking at starting my day early like you do. My question is what time do you go to bed what time do you wake up and what’s the evening routine so you can get to bed at a decent time?

    • @gatheredandgroundedhomeschool
      @gatheredandgroundedhomeschool  2 місяці тому

      I go up to bed at 9, do all the goodnight stuff with the kids and im probably in bed asleep by 10. wake up right around 5am.
      I am normally done eating dinner and kitchen cleaned up by 5ish
      5-7 I just do whatever I need to, shower….read….clean something….do nothing
      I have no phone after 7ish, so no social media scrolling. Hubby and I are normally catching up from the day, watching shows so it’s definitely a wind down time til bed.
